Realistic designs of silica hollow-core photonic bandgap fibers free of surface modes

Abstract

By systematically studying feasible silica PBGFs core structures we identify new designs regimes that robustly eliminate the presence of surface modes. New realistic fibers designs with a fundamental mode free of anticrossings at all frequencies within the bandgap are proposed.
